Description

NGC 2841 is an unbarred spiral galaxy in the northern circumpolar constellation of Ursa Major. It was discovered on 9 March 1788 by German-born astronomer William Herschel
Initially thought to be about 30 million light-years distant. Source: Wikipedia

Red 30 x 240s bin 1x1
Grn 30 x 240s bin 1x1
Blu 30 x 240s bin 1x1

Note the faint galaxies around the image. An exceptional clear cloudless sky last night which allowed for a clean image.
